Understanding Homeownership Costs in Oconto Falls
Owning a home in Oconto Falls is a rewarding experience, but it comes with various costs beyond the mortgage. Being informed about these expenses can help you budget appropriately.
Property Taxes and Insurance
- Homeowners must pay annual property taxes, which can significantly impact monthly budgets.
- Home insurance is crucial for protecting your investment, with rates varying based on home value and coverage.
Maintenance and Repairs
- Regular maintenance is necessary to keep homes in good condition, often requiring an annual budget of 1-3% of the home's value.
- Be prepared for unexpected repairs, such as plumbing or electrical issues, which can arise at any time.
Utilities and Landscaping
- Monthly utility bills can add up, including electricity, water, and heating, especially during harsh winters.
- Maintaining a yard or garden may involve additional costs, such as landscaping, lawn care, and snow removal.
Quick Tips
- Set aside a percentage of your income for home maintenance and unexpected repairs.
- Shop around for home insurance to find the best rates.
- Regularly assess your utility usage to identify potential savings.
Frequently Asked Questions
How much can I expect to pay for property taxes?
Property taxes in Oconto Falls are based on the assessed value of your home and vary annually. Homeowners should review their assessment notices for specific rates applicable to their properties.
What types of home insurance are recommended?
It’s advisable to obtain comprehensive home insurance that covers property damage, liability, and additional living expenses. Consult with local insurance agents to determine the best policy for your specific needs.
Are there seasonal maintenance tasks I should be aware of?
Yes, homeowners should prepare for seasonal tasks such as winterizing pipes, cleaning gutters in the fall, and maintaining HVAC systems. A seasonal checklist can help ensure that essential maintenance is not overlooked.
How do utility costs typically compare in Oconto Falls?
Utility costs in Oconto Falls are generally lower than in larger urban areas, but winter heating costs can be significant. Homeowners should plan for increased utility expenditures during the colder months.
Is landscaping necessary for home value?
While landscaping is not mandatory, well-maintained outdoor spaces can enhance curb appeal and potentially increase property value. Investing in basic landscaping can create a welcoming environment for both homeowners and visitors.
